Griffith Borgeson (December 21, 1918 - June 29, 1997) was an influential American race car historian, described by the Society of Automotive Engineers as one of the world's preeminent automotive historians. His most well-known work, The Golden Age of the American Racing Car, almost single handedly rescued the memory of an entire era of brilliant race car work in the United States, an era whose memory was being lost.
